CPAP machines are highly effective for treating sleep apnea, but some users may experience minor side effects when starting therapy. The good news is that most of these issues are temporary and can be easily solved.

A poorly fitted mask can cause irritation or pressure marks.
Solution: Choose the right mask size and adjust straps properly.
Air leaks reduce therapy effectiveness and disturb sleep.
Solution: Ensure proper mask fitting and replace worn-out cushions.
New users may feel uncomfortable with airflow initially.
Solution: Use ramp mode to gradually increase pressure.
Continuous mask contact may cause redness or irritation.
Solution: Clean mask regularly and use soft padding.

If side effects persist for a long time or worsen, consult a healthcare professional for proper guidance.
Despite minor issues, CPAP therapy significantly improves sleep quality, reduces snoring, and prevents serious health risks like heart disease.
Are CPAP side effects permanent?
No, most side effects are temporary and can be easily managed.
Is CPAP safe to use daily?
Yes, it is safe and recommended for long-term use.
How to reduce CPAP discomfort?
Use proper mask fitting, humidifier, and adjust pressure settings.
